Early Academic Pursuits:

Her academic journey with a Bachelor's degree in Economics from the Universita' degli Studi di Parma, Italy, graduating with top honors (110/110 con lode). She continued her studies with a Master's degree in Development Economics at the same institution, achieving another outstanding academic performance. Subsequently, she pursued her Ph.D. in Economics at Vilfredo Pareto, Universita' degli studi di Torino – Collegio Carlo Alberto, Turin, Italy, with a thesis titled "Resilience and Innovation: Evolutionary Perspectives and Empirical Evidence," earning her doctorate in March 2017.

Professional Endeavors:

Her rich professional background, including significant roles in academia and research. Currently serving as an Assistant Professor of Economics at Dublin City University Business School since August 2019, she plays a pivotal role in shaping the academic experiences of students. Prior to this,Her held a Post-Doctoral Research Fellow position at University College Dublin from June 2017 to July 2019, contributing to the ERC project TechEvo.

Her professional journey also includes a visiting researcher role at Cambridge Judge Business School in the UK and traineeships at the European Food Safety Authority and the Italian Ministry of Economics and Finance.

Research Focus and Contributions:

Her research has focused on topics such as innovation, technological coherence, adaptive resilience of regional economies, and the effects of technological diversification shocks on regional growth. Her work spans across diverse geographical contexts, including studies on the Italian automotive sector during economic downturns.

Early Academic Pursuits:

Prof. Dr. Hamza Semmari began his academic journey with a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ering, specializing in Energetic and Fluid Mechanics, from the University of Boumerdes, Algeria, in 2007. He continued his studies with a Master's degree in Mechanical Engineering, focusing on Energetic, Heat Transfer, and Combustion, at the same university from 2007 to 2009. his then pursued a Ph.D. in Engineering Science, with an option in Thermodynamics and Energetics, at the University of Perpignan Via Domitia UPDV & PROMES-CNRS Laboratory in France from 2009 to 2012. He received the Ph.D. with Highest Honors.

Professional Endeavors:

His built an extensive career as a Certified Energy Transformation Expert and a former Pan Arab Certified Energy Management Professional. He is currently a Professor and Research Team Leader at the Ecole Nationale Polytechnique de Constantine in Algeria. His expertise extends to various areas, including energy efficiency, biomass utilization for electricity production, energy resource management, flare systems, techno-economic studies, waste heat recovery, applied thermodynamics, optimization, and advanced energy systems.

Research Focus and Projects:

His research interests encompass energy efficiency, biomass utilization, flare gas valorization, techno-economic studies, and waste heat recovery. his  been actively involved in numerous research projects, including leading the research group for the "Flare gas valorisation for electricity production through ORC systems." He has contributed to international projects, such as UNESCO's IGCP 636 on geothermal resources for energy transition.
